Recurring Events
Every Monday (May 21-Sept. 3)
Market in the Park at Victoria Park, 9 am - 3 pm, Free Admission.
Every Friday (June-August)
Co-ed Beach Volleyball at Station Beach - 7 pm. Contact: Doug
Holtby 519 396-8184
Every Saturday (May 19-Oct. 6)
Kincardine Agricultural Society's Farmers Market at
Connaught Park, 8 AM to 12 noon, featuring local
produce, meats, preserves, baked goods, honey and plants.
Every Saturday (June 23-Labour Day)
Kincardine Scottish Pipe Band Parade and concert every Sat evening in the summer. Parade leaves
Victoria Park at 8:00 pm and follows Queen Street. Visit Kincardine Tourism for more information
Every Sunday (July-August)
Sunday evening sing-a-longs 7:30-8:30 pm. Dunsmoor Park. Rain location: Davidson Centre
Every Evening excluding Saturdays (July-August)
Enjoy the sounds of the of the bagpipes at sunset as the sun is piped to sleep from atop the lighthouse, directly across from the Inn! An unforgettable
setting and experience
